Pro-Palestinian Protest Disrupted Brussels Christmas Market Opening
The launch of Brussels’ Winter Wonders Christmas market was interrupted when demonstrators set off smoke bombs, waved Palestinian flags, and unsettled families.
The opening ceremony of the Winter Wonders Christmas market at Place de la Bourse in Brussels was disrupted by a pro-Palestinian protest on Friday evening. Protesters reportedly identifying as Muslims entered the market area, waving Palestinian flags, carrying torches and drums, and igniting smoke bombs among the Christmas stalls. Witnesses described families leaving the square in fear and children being visibly frightened and confused.
Several politicians have condemned the incident. Police restored order without reports of injuries or arrests, and organisers expressed disappointment, stressing that the market was intended as a community space for joy and togetherness.
